They also can affect plants by reducing root growth and nutrient uptake.Ĭurrently the single-biggest source of microplastic pollution in soil, is fertilizers produced from organic matter such as manure.Īlthough these can be cheaper and better for the environment that manufactured fertilizers, the manure is mixed with the same plastic microspheres that are known to be commonly used in certain soaps, shampoos, and makeup products. These microplastics can change the physical structure of the earth underfoot and limit its capacity to hold water. UNEP’s experts explain that over time, big pieces of plastic can break into shards less than 5 mm long and seep into the soil. Microplastics come in a large variety of sizes, colours and chemical compositions, and include fibres, fragments, pellets, flakes, sheets or foams.
